An early Bitcoin adopter has made a bold prediction, suggesting that BTC could experience another massive bull run, potentially reaching a 100X increase from its current price. This optimistic outlook is based on several factors, including increasing institutional adoption, the scarcity created by Bitcoin halvings, and advancements in technology that make Bitcoin more accessible to retail investors.

According to a Cointelegraph report on June 16, 2025, Bitcoin maximalist Brad Mills has forecasted a significant rally. Mills believes the market is entering a "SaylorCycle," a decade-long growth period driven by Michael Saylor's influence and MicroStrategy's substantial Bitcoin holdings. MicroStrategy currently holds 592,100 BTC, and Mills expects this trend of institutional accumulation to continue, further fueling Bitcoin's growth.

Several factors support this potential for exponential growth. The increasing adoption of Bitcoin by institutional investors is a primary driver. As more institutions allocate capital to Bitcoin, the demand increases, leading to upward price pressure. The scarcity of Bitcoin, which is inherent in its design with a limited supply of 21 million coins, is further exacerbated by events like the halving. Halvings reduce the rate at which new Bitcoins are created, effectively cutting the supply and historically leading to price surges.

Moreover, technological developments are making it easier for retail investors to access and use Bitcoin. User-friendly wallets, exchanges, and educational resources are lowering the barriers to entry, attracting a broader range of investors. This increased accessibility can lead to greater demand and, consequently, higher prices.

While a 100X increase may seem ambitious, historical data and market trends suggest it is not entirely out of the realm of possibility. PlanB, known for the stock-to-flow (S2F) model, argues that Bitcoin follows a long-term power-law trend that has historically signaled major bull cycles. These cycles have seen price jumps of 100x, 10x, and 4x in the past. If this model holds, Bitcoin could be primed for a 5-10x increase from current levels, potentially reaching a cycle top between $500,000 and $1,000,000.

However, it's important to acknowledge the inherent volatility and risk associated with cryptocurrency investments. Bitcoin's price is subject to significant fluctuations influenced by various factors, including regulatory changes, macroeconomic conditions, and market sentiment. As Bitpanda Academy noted on June 16, 2025, some analysts caution that Bitcoin's price could drop significantly in the coming years, potentially falling below $20,000. Such a decline could be triggered by global economic uncertainties, stricter regulations, or declining demand.

Despite these potential risks, the long-term outlook for Bitcoin remains positive for many analysts. Binance, in its Bitcoin price prediction, suggests that the value of BTC could increase by +5% and reach $137,336.46 by 2030. Kraken provides a similar forecast, estimating a price of €118,266.63 by 2030, based on a 5% annual growth rate.

Ultimately, whether Bitcoin will achieve another 100X cycle remains uncertain. However, the confluence of factors such as institutional adoption, scarcity, and technological advancements suggests that Bitcoin has the potential for significant growth in the coming years.
